Communication is a specifically human activity, considered both an art and a science that can be learned, or a tool that can help us succeed both personally and professionally. At the same time, communication is the fundamental way of psychosocial interaction between people, a process of spiritual connection that requires the correct and efficient knowledge and use of the elements of language. A competent speaker knows what, when, how, and to whom to speak, and takes care of the quality and quantity of the vocabulary used in the communication process, the observance of speaking/communication norms, and the culture of speech. Communication is classified into verbal and nonverbal communication, with verbal communication occurring in both oral and written forms through the use of words, as signs of language. When talking about communication, we must refer to the language system, speech, language, and context. In the communication process, for it to be persuasive and constructive, we must consider the interlocutor, the context, certain norms, as well as the denotation and connotation of words |
